Built-in 12G UHD-SDI 75Ω Bidirectional I/O 'LMH1297'
The LMH1297 can use a single BNC as an input/output port, making it easier to design UHD video hardware. It can be configured in input mode as an adaptive cable equalizer and in output mode as a dual cable driver. The built-in reclocker automatically locks to all SMPTE data rates up to 11.88Gbps in both modes. The bidirectional I/O features on-chip 75Ω termination and return loss compensation networks, meeting SMPTE's strict return loss requirements. An additional 75Ω driver output supports various system functions. In EQ (equalizer) mode, this second 75Ω driver can be used as a loop-through output. In CD (cable driver) mode, this 75Ω driver can be used as a second fan-out cable driver. **Features** - User-configurable adaptive cable equalizer/cable driver with built-in reclocker - Supports ST-2082-1 (12G), ST-2081-1 (6G), ST-424 (3G), ST-292 (HD), ST-259 (SD) - DVB-ASI and AES10 (MADI) compatible - Locks SMPTE rates at 11.88Gbps, 5.94Gbps, 2.97Gbps, 1.485Gbps - Equalizer Mode - Adaptive cable equalizer with built-in reclocker - 100Ω output driver with de-emphasis - Reclocked 75Ω loop-through output - Cable Driver Mode - Dual differential output cable driver with built-in reclocker - Adaptive PCB input equalizer - Reclocked 100Ω loopback output - Automatic pre-emphasis and slew rate control at 75Ω output - Polarity inversion at 75Ω and 100Ω outputs - Programmable via pin, SPI, and SMBus interfaces - Operating temperature range: -40℃ to +85℃ - 32-pin QFN package measuring 5mm square *For more details, please contact us.*

【Usage】 ■ SMPTE compatible serial digital interface ■ UHDTV/4K/8K/HDTV/SDTV video ■ IP media gateway ■ Digital video processing/editing, etc. *For more details, please contact us.
